Given the following information:

n = 200 | x = 155

Determine the 80% confidence interval estimate for the population proportion.

Homework Answers

Answer #1

We have given,          
          
x=155      
n=200      
Estimate for sample proportion=0.775
Z critical value(using Z table)=1.28  
Confidence interval formula is

=(0.7372,0.8128)


Lower limit for confidence interval=0.7372
          
Upper limit for confidence interval=0.8128
